Boxscore

Team123Score
Los Angeles1001
Columbus2103
First Period
- 1, Columbus Goal - Mark Letestu (6), from James Wisniewski and Vinny Prospal at 9:14. 2, Los Angeles Short-Handed Goal - Anze Kopitar (20), from Dustin Brown at 12:22. 3, Columbus Goal - Jack Johnson (10), from Derick Brassard and R.J. Umberger at 19:51. Penalties - Willie Mitchell, Los Angeles (Hi-sticking), 11:05; James Wisniewski, Columbus (Tripping), 17:26.
Second Period
- 4, Columbus Goal - Mark Letestu (7), from Maksim Mayorov and Vinny Prospal at 3:07. Penalties - Alec Martinez, Los Angeles (Roughing), 5:52; Matt Greene, Los Angeles (Roughing), 5:52; Derek Dorsett, Columbus (Roughing), 5:52; Jarret Stoll, Los Angeles (Interference), 11:08.
Third Period
- No scoring. Penalties - Willie Mitchell, Los Angeles (Boarding), :53; Drew Doughty, Los Angeles (Hooking), 15:16.
Shots on Goal:  Los Angeles 12 + 9 + 9 = 30. Columbus 15 + 11 + 10 = 36.
Power Play Conversion:  Los Angeles 0-1. Columbus 0-5.
Goaltenders:  Los Angeles, Jonathan Bernier 3-36-.917. Columbus, Steve Mason 1-17-.941; Curtis Sanford 0-13-1.000.
Referees:  Steve Kozari, Marcus Vinnerborg
Linesmen:  Bryan Pancich, Mark Wheler
